Name: Goodwind Goblin
Job: Pediatrician
Class: Warrior

Biography:

Goodwind is a Goblin warrior pediatrician with no formal doctor experience. He was formally a professional soldier but switched professions recently after discovering some doctor belongings. He's not very bright and is quick to temper. Cures through brute force bludgeoning. Hasn't officially cured a patient. Is none the less a good natured goblin. Despite being somewhat dull is creative in unconventional ways. Might be into self injections.
